Renovation of an educational facility in Brockport, New York. Completed plans call for the renovation of a educational facility.
The work of this single bid project includes, but is not limited to the following: Site utilities work shall include replacement of underground utilities and structures including storm sewer and connection of utilities outside of buildings. Asbestos abatement work shall include removal of building waterproofing and removal of underground asbestos storm pipe. Landscaping and site work shall include site regrading, sidewalk installations, asphalt paving, site furnishings and landscaping, trees, plantings. Electrical work shall include decorative site lighting, underground conduit and cable installation and misc. power as shown on the drawings. Prometheus statue removal shall include the scope of work within allowance: The contractor is to directly hire McKay Lodge Conservation Laboratory to deconstruct and turn over Prometheus Statue to Campus; McKay Lodge deconstruction and removal of Prometheus statue and McKay Lodge effort to turn statue over to Campus for storage. Scope of base contract work to be performed by contractor includes removal of the statue concrete foundation and steel reinforcement; Contractor responsible for providing equipment and operators; 60' boom aerial lift, 55' shooting boom forklift and 26' enclosed truck for transportation, assumed three weeks required for each; Three operators, assumed 120 hours for each.
